Wellington Arch and Royal Artillery Memorial can be found in Greater London, United Kingdom. The arch was built in 1828, commissioned by the Duke of Wellington and was originally installed opposite Apsley House (Wellington's London home). The Royal Artillery Memorial was installed shortly after World War I in honor of the fallen from the Royal Artillery. This memorial is located in the park that the Wellington Arch overlooks, appropriately named Hyde Park.

The Wellington Arch is an iconic symbol of British history and military accomplishment. It is considered one of the capital's great monuments and draws its own special charm. From the arch itself or the surrounding parks, visitors will be able to see sites such as Buckingham Palace, Green Park and the Horse Guards Parade. With so much to offer, Wellington Arch and the Royal Artillery Memorial make for a great place to visit.
